LEADING CAUSES OF JOB INJURIES.(Brief Article)
May 1, 2001... Index lists top 10 problems
1 Overexertion -- too much lifting, pushing, pulling, holding, carrying or throwing of an object
2 Falls on the same level
3 Bending, climbing, loss of balance, slipping without falling
